什么是高分辨率计时器?
高分辨率计时器是一种工具,用于测量极其短暂的时间间隔,其精度通常在毫秒甚至纳秒级别。这在调试、性能分析和优化应用程序时尤为重要。通过使用高分辨率计时器,开发人员可以更准确地分析代码的执行时间,识别性能瓶颈,并做出相应的优化。
为什么在Fiddler中使用高分辨率计时器?
Fiddler是一款强大的网络调试代理工具,广泛用于捕获和分析HTTP/HTTPS流量。在Fiddler中启用高分辨率计时器可以帮助开发人员更精确地测量请求和响应之间的时间,从而更好地了解网络延迟和应用性能。这对于需要进行详细性能分析和优化的开发人员来说,尤为有用。
如何在Fiddler中启用高分辨率计时器
在Fiddler中启用高分辨率计时器非常简单,以下是具体步骤:
步骤一:打开Fiddler
首先,确保你的计算机上已安装并运行Fiddler。如果尚未安装,可以从Fiddler官方网站下载并进行安装。
步骤二:访问Fiddler选项
启动Fiddler后,点击菜单栏中的“Tools”选项,然后选择“Options”以打开设置窗口。
步骤三:启用高分辨率计时器
在“Options”窗口中,切换到“Performance”标签页。在这个标签页中,你会看到一个名为“Enable High-Resolution Timers”的选项。勾选这个选项,然后点击“OK”以保存设置。
验证高分辨率计时器是否生效
为了确保高分辨率计时器已经在Fiddler中成功启用,你可以进行以下验证步骤:
步骤一:捕获网络流量
返回Fiddler主界面,确保开始捕获网络流量。你可以通过点击工具栏中的“Start”按钮来开始捕获。
步骤二:检查时间戳
捕获一些网络请求后,查看请求和响应的详细信息。在详细信息面板中,你应该能看到以高精度显示的时间戳。如果时间戳显示精度达到了毫秒或更高精度,则表示高分辨率计时器已经成功启用。
总结
在Fiddler中启用高分辨率计时器可以显著提升网络请求和响应时间测量的精度。这对于需要进行详细性能分析和优化的开发人员来说,是一个非常有用的功能。通过按照本文提供的步骤,您可以轻松在Fiddler中启用高分辨率计时器,并开始享受更精确的时间测量。